Multipanel plot dimensions. Default (1,1) (one panel). Dimensions of one panel. Relative proportions between the plot panel and ratio panel. Default 0.7. Row indices for which ratio plot won't be shown. Dictionary of y-limits for each row. Dictionary of minimum and maximum y-limits for each row - applied if plot point exceeds these limits. Ignored for a row if rowBounds has a setting for it. Dictionary of x-limits for each column. Dictionary of y-limits for the ratio panels in each row. If True, a dashed line will be drawn to indicate a zero difference line. Difference type "ratio" (a/b) or "diff" (a-b). Plot systematics separately in ratio plot. Draw systematic error patches in legend. Default true. Dictionary of scale factors for the plots in each panel. List of panels that should have their own y-axis scale instead of a shared one. Dictionary of y-limits for each panel included in panelPrivateScale. List of panels ratios that should have their own y-axis instead of a shared one. Dictionary of y-limits for each panel ratio included in panelPrivateScale. Fractional width of the systematic uncertainty patches with relation to the panel width. Default 0.065. str or Dict {colId:str, ...}. xlabel for all panels (str), or dictionary of xlabels for each column. str or Dict {rowN:str, ...}. ylabel for all panels. str or Dict {rowN:str, ...}. ylabel for all panels on the right side. str or Dict {rowN:str, ...}. ylabel for the ratio panels (default "Ratio" or "Diff"). Axis label text size. Default 16. Tick labe size. Default 13. Maximum number of major ticks on the x-axis. Default 6. Multiples of the major ticks. By default not used (None). Apply logarithmic scale to each panel. Draw data points which error bar goes below zero as a upper limit marker. Default false. Dictionary of panel labels. Location for the panel labels in each panel. Default (0.2,0.92). Panel label text size. Default 16. Text alignment for the panel labels, "left", "center", "right" (default). int or Dict {legendId:panelIndex, ...}. Index (indices) of the panel(s) where to pace the legend. Use dictionary if multiple legends is wanted. Tuple (x, y) or Dict {legendId:(x,y), ...}. Legend location(s) in the panel(s). Legend text size. Default 10. Plot curves with plot.Add(...). Input curve should be either as numpy arrays, or ROOT objects. Add automatically converts a TGraphErrors and TH1 object to numpy arrays and plots them. Returns the index for the newly added plot (int), which can be used as a reference for ratio plotting. The following options are available for the plotType parameter. Additional styling may be specified by supplying valid arguments that will be passed on to the respective matplotlib methods.
